Description

Petroleum Economics & Finance Masterclass 2013 is a course that covers topics such as:

  • Annual report interpretation: statements, financial ratios, what is and is not included
  • Cash flow techniques, economic evaluation and budgeting
  • Pricing: natural gas and crudes, OPEC, spot and futures markets, transportation, hedging
  • The global oil market
  • The growth of the Australian domestic gas, LNG and unconventional gas markets
  • Managing commodity risk
  • Equity markets, sources of funds and how the market assesses oil and gas investments
  • The interface between oil companies and the stock market
  • How projects affect the organisation and corporate profits
  • Project evaluation in emerging economies: sovereign risk and credit risk
  • Investment opportunities weighing risk and uncertainty
  • Economic factors regarding concessions, licenses, contracts, JVs, cost of capital, funding alternatives and production sharing agreements

Petroleum Economics & Finance Masterclass 2013 is intended for Managers, supervisors and operating personnel.
